by Steve Gibson, Oct 28, 2000 9:20am PDTThere is a whole bunch of new Evil Dead stuff to look at on the official website. They've slapped up some video footage of the game, busted out with a FAQ for you to read and (hopefully) answer your questions, and even got themselves a developer diary going (Thanks BluesNews) You can also check out the screenshots of the game that were released.
On one level, we're trying to make a game that can compete with other survival horror games using a third of the budget, time and manpower typically allotted for the Resident Evil's of the world. Like any game, you start with a grand design that ends up changing throughout production, often significantly. And as you near the end, you wonder whether you made the right decisions, whether the game is going to be great or if it will suck, whether the press and fans will love it or hate it.
